Blind Vengeance is a gritty TV movie that dives into the dark corners of revenge and justice. Directed by Lee Philips, it’s anchored by a raw performance from its lead, who portrays a father grappling with unbearable loss. The pacing here is deliberate, allowing the tension to build as he meticulously plans his retribution against the white supremacists who escaped justice. The atmosphere is thick with despair and anger, underscoring the film's themes around racial hatred and personal vengeance. You don't see a lot of practical effects, but the emotional weight carries you through. It’s a tough watch but offers a unique approach to its subject matter, making it stand out in the crime drama genre of its time.
